Savers Health and Beauty is seeking an Apprentice Retail Sales Assistant in Pontypridd, UK. This position offers a thorough training period without college days, leading to a Retailer Level 2 Apprenticeship. You will work in a fast-paced environment, connecting with the community and enhancing customer experiences.
Benefits include:
- Up to 28 days holiday
- Digital healthcare services
- A clear progression plan
Ideal candidates will have a grade 4 / C GCSE in English and Maths and be eligible to work in the UK.

How to prepare for a job interview at myGwork - LGBTQ+ Business Community
✨Know the Company
Before your interview, take some time to research Savers Health and Beauty. Understand their values, products, and what makes them stand out in the retail sector.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Show Your Customer Service Skills
As an Apprentice Retail Sales Associate, you'll be interacting with customers regularly.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've provided excellent customer service or resolved issues. This will demonstrate your ability to enhance customer experiences, which is key for this role.
✨Prepare for Common Interview Questions
Think about common interview questions related to retail and customer service. Questions like 'How would you handle a difficult customer?' or 'What does good customer service mean to you?' are likely to come up. Practising your answers will help you feel more confident during the interview.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Use this opportunity to inquire about the training process, career progression, or the team culture at Savers.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can grow within the company.
